概括
使用18 Estradiol PET 的雌激素受体 (ER) 向成像对于计划和选择乳腺癌患者的内分泌治疗至关重要. 这种方法有助于个性化治疗策略,以改善患者的治疗结果.

背景情况:
- 雌激素受体 (ER) 状态是选择乳腺癌内分泌治疗的关键决定因素.
- 准确评估ER表达对于有效的治疗计划至关重要.
- 目前评估ER状态的方法在某些临床情景中可能存在局限性.

Positron emission tomography (PET) is a medical imaging technique involving radiopharmaceuticals — substances that emit short-lived radiation. Although the first PET scanner was introduced in 1961, it took 15 more years before radiopharmaceuticals were combined with the technique and revolutionized its potential.
One of the main requirements of a PET scan is a positron-emitting radioisotope, which is produced in a cyclotron and then attached to a substance used by the part of the body...

Positron Emission Tomography (PET) is a medical imaging technique that provides crucial insights into the body's physiological functions at a molecular level. It is an indispensable resource for diagnosing, staging, and monitoring various illnesses, notably cancer, neurological disorders, and cardiovascular conditions.
